KillOrderTBC — Smart Kill Priority for TBC Classic
Color-coded nameplates that tell you exactly who to kill first,
the moment you walk into a dungeon. No setup required.
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
CORE FEATURES
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
12 ROLE TYPES — each with its own configurable color
World Boss · Elite Healer · Healer
Elite Caster · Caster · Elite Ranged · Ranged
Elite Melee · Melee · Elite Tank · Tank · Unknown
Elites automatically promote to their sub-role the moment
they appear — no teaching required.
ROLE BAR — colored pill bar beneath every mob's health bar
Shows role name and kill priority number.
Elites get a gold ★ border. World Bosses get an orange ☠.
Your current target pulses. Everything else can dim to
invisible so you focus on what matters.
AUTO ROLE DETECTION — works out of the box
Layer 1 — Static database: 200+ TBC dungeon NPCs built in
Layer 2 — Mana bar check: mana = caster bucket,
no mana = melee bucket. Instant, no cast needed.
Layer 3 — Cast observation: sees a heal → Healer (high
confidence). Sees a damage spell → Caster.
Sees a shot → Ranged. Saved permanently.
Layer 4 — Creature type and name keyword fallback.
250+ named TBC abilities are classified across healer,
caster, ranged, melee, and tank spell tables. The addon
learns a mob once and never asks again.
TARGET ALERT BAR — HUD bar for your current target
Shows role name and kill priority on screen.
Configurable size, colors, text, and position.
PRIORITY WINDOW — 12 draggable rows
Drag to reorder your kill priority. Double-click to recolor.
Live update — nameplates reflect changes instantly.
Dim divider separates bright roles from fully-hidden ones.
Your current target always shows at full brightness,
regardless of dim setting.
GROUP SYNC
/ko mt — broadcasts your target to the group;
highlighted on all members' nameplates
/ko sync — pushes your full priority order to the group
ASSIST MODE
Cycles through visible hostiles in kill-priority order.
Bind in: WoW Menu → Key Bindings → AddOns → KillOrderTBC
MINIMAP BUTTON
Left-click — Priority Window
Right-click — Options
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
OPTIONS
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
Enable · Nameplate Range · Alert Bar · Assist Mode
Appearance (5 themes, scale, opacity)
Fine Tuning (glow, pulse, dim, badge)
Actions (reset, rescan)
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
SLASH COMMANDS
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
/ko Open Priority Window
/ko options Open Options
/ko teach <role> Assign role to current target
/ko mt Toggle MT target broadcast
/ko sync Push priority order to group
/ko assist Toggle Assist Mode
/ko reset Clear learned NPC cache
/ko scan Force nameplate rescan
/ko debug Print diagnostics to chat
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
INSTALLATION
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
1. Extract KillOrderTBC into Interface\AddOns\
2. Enable at character select
3. Enter a dungeon — done
Tip: type /ko and enable Show Nameplates on first launch.
The addon handles everything else automatically.
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
DUNGEONS COVERED (static database)
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━
Hellfire Ramparts · Blood Furnace · Shattered Halls
Slave Pens · Underbog · Steamvault
Mechanar · Botanica · Arcatraz
Mana-Tombs · Auchenai Crypts · Sethekk Halls
Shadow Labyrinth · Old Hillsbrad · Black Morass
Magister's Terrace · Karazhan trash